The Al-Zuhri Institute of Higher Learning was established in 2000 and began offering the Diploma in Islamic Studies (DPI) program in 2002. Al-Zuhri is supported by the Islamic Religious Council of Singapore (MUIS) and the Association of Muslim Scholars and Religious Teachers of Singapore (PERGAS).
Andalus began operating in 1996 in Bukit Batok. At that time, it was just one classroom. Alhamdulillah, with the help of Allah SWT, today there are 16 Andalus branches throughout Singapore.
The establishment of the Cordova Education Centre was founded by several directors in collaboration with Andalus Corporation in June 1998. In 1999, the Cordova Education Centre was able to operate fully. Cordova provides religious education for children to adults.

Qurban Project 2025: Spreading Joy and Compassion in Mindanao
Qurban Project 2025 brought Eid al-Adha celebrations to underprivileged Muslim families in Sarangani Province, General Santos City, and Polomolok, South Cotabato on June 7-8, 2025.
This collaboration between Halwani Services – Singapore and Al IHSAN Resource Center, Inc. – Philippines fulfilled the Sunnah of Eid al-Adha by performing ritual sacrifices and distributing meat to those in need, promoting unity and compassion within the community.
Project Highlights:
  • 75 Goats Sacrificed: All sacrifices followed Islamic guidelines, benefiting numerous families.
  • Widespread Distribution: Both cooked meals and raw meat packs reached disadvantaged households, orphans, students, widows, Imams, and the elderly.
  • Community Engagement: Local volunteers and leaders ensured smooth implementation.
  • Local Support: Goats were purchased from small-scale local farmers, supporting community livelihoods.
